BIO
Oscar Troya is an Ecuadorian DJ and Producer based in Florida, recognized as one of the most influential electronic music artists in his country and a rising figure in the international scene.
With more than 600 performances in clubs and festivals around the world, he has established himself as a headliner at Ecuador’s biggest festivals, bringing his music to thousands of people. His career started early: at just 15 years old, he became a resident DJ at the most important club in Ecuador, and since then his growth has been unstoppable.
He has shared the stage with industry giants such as Martin Garrix, Armin Van Buuren, Alesso, Nicky Romero, Nervo, and Paul Van Dyk, among others. His music has reached the top spots on local radio charts and has been featured on Spotify, Apple Music, and Deezer. He has produced official remixes for international labels such as Warner Music and Universal Music Group, and in 2016 he launched his own radio show, Overdrive, broadcast in more than seven cities across Latin America.
His career achievements include multiple awards, most notably being recognized by Disco Rojo as Ecuador’s Best DJ. His track “Shapes” was selected as Track of the Week by Spinnin’ Records and featured on Spinnin’ Sessions #146.
